The Role of a Professional Door Technician

Professional door technicians are specialized in the setup, maintenance, and repair of various kinds of doors, locks, and access control systems. Their role is complex and extends beyond merely repairing broken doors. Here are a few of the essential obligations of a professional door specialist:

Installation and Setup

  • Installing new doors, locks, and hardware in domestic, business, and commercial settings.
  • Establishing access control systems, consisting of electronic locks and keycard readers.
  • Guaranteeing that all installations meet safety and security standards.

Repair and maintenance

  • Frequently checking and keeping doors and locks to prevent concerns.
  • Fixing broken or malfunctioning doors, hinges, and locks.
  • Fixing and solving issues with access control systems.

Security Assessments

  • Carrying out security assessments to identify vulnerabilities in a building's gain access to points.
  • Advising and implementing security upgrades, such as installing high-security locks or enhancing door frames.

Customer support

  • Providing outstanding customer care by interacting successfully with customers.
  • Offering advice and assistance on door and lock maintenance.
  • Making sure that clients are satisfied with the service provided.

Compliance and Safety

  • Making sure that all work complies with local structure codes and regulations.
  • Adhering to security procedures to prevent accidents and injuries.

Skills and Qualifications

To excel as a professional door service technician, one must possess a combination of technical skills, physical abilities, and interpersonal qualities. Here are some of the vital abilities and qualifications:

  • Technical Expertise: A deep understanding of door and lock mechanisms, along with experience with various kinds of gain access to control systems.
  • Problem-Solving Skills: The capability to diagnose and resolve complex concerns effectively.
  • Physical Stamina: The task often involves lifting heavy doors, working in tight spaces, and standing for extended periods.
  • Attention to Detail: Precision is vital when setting up or fixing locks and hardware.
  • Customer Support Skills: Effective communication and the capability to work well with clients.
  • Certifications: Many door technicians hold accreditations from professional organizations, such as the Door and Hardware Institute (DHI).

FAQs About Professional Door Technicians

Q: What is the average salary for a professional door professional?A: The wage for a professional door service technician can differ depending upon aspects such as area, experience, and specialization. On average, door technicians can make between ₤ 30,000 and ₤ 60,000 each year, with more experienced professionals making greater wages.

Q: What are the most common types of doors and locks that door technicians deal with?A: Door technicians deal with a large range of doors and locks, including:

  • Residential doors and locks (e.g., deadbolts, lever handles)
  • Commercial doors and locks (e.g., exit devices, panic bars)
  • Industrial doors and locks (e.g., high-security locks, electronic access control systems)
  • Specialized doors (e.g., fire-rated doors, automated sliding doors)

Q: How can I become a professional door professional?A: To become a professional door technician, you can follow these actions:

  • Complete a high school diploma or equivalent.
  • Enlist in a trade school or occupation program that provides courses in door and lock setup and repair.
  • Gain hands-on experience through an apprenticeship or entry-level position.
  • Think about getting accreditations from professional companies like the Door and Hardware Institute (DHI).

Q: What tools do professional door technicians use?A: Professional door technicians use a variety of tools, consisting of:

  • Screwdrivers, wrenches, and pliers
  • Lock choices and tension wrenches
  • Power tools (e.g., drills, saws)
  • Measuring tools (e.g., tape measures, calipers)
  • Diagnostic equipment for electronic gain access to control systems
